A court here on Tuesday acceded to request of the former Telecom Minister, A. Raja, and two others, allegedly involved in the 2G spectrum scam, that their appearance in court, when their remand expires on March 17, be facilitated through videoconferencing from the Tihar jail. The other two petitioners are the former Telecom Secretary, Siddhartha Behura, and Mr. Raja's former private secretary, R. K. Chandolia.
Plea to defreeze bank accounts
Mr. Behura's bail application will be heard on March 18 along with his plea for de-freezing his bank accounts.
On Monday, another accused, Shahid Usman Balwa, availed himself of the videoconferencing facility on the heels of Mr. Raja doing so earlier also.
